50% tariff shock: India in touch with Mexico over ‘unilateral’ move; aim for 'stable and balanced trade environment'

5 months ago

India is actively engaging with Mexico over a "unilateral" tariff hike of up to 50% on a wide range of products. New Delhi seeks solutions beneficial to both nations while protecting Indian exporters' interests, as the increased duties are set to take effect from January 1, 2026.
